Browse Source

SDL_EnumerateDirectory(): (posix) Fix return value when directory is invalid

Petar Popovic 9 months ago
parent
commit
8468c372b2
1 changed files with 1 additions and 2 deletions
  1. 1 2
      src/filesystem/posix/SDL_sysfsops.c

+ 1 - 2
src/filesystem/posix/SDL_sysfsops.c

@@ -40,8 +40,7 @@ bool SDL_SYS_EnumerateDirectory(const char *path, const char *dirname, SDL_Enume
 
     DIR *dir = opendir(path);
     if (!dir) {
-        SDL_SetError("Can't open directory: %s", strerror(errno));
-        return -1;
+        return SDL_SetError("Can't open directory: %s", strerror(errno));
     }
 
     struct dirent *ent;